About Newland Green

Newland Green is a small, rural hamlet located within the Ashford district of Kent, in the South East of England. Situated a few miles south-east of Headcorn and north-west of Tenterden, it is nestled amidst the agricultural landscape of the Weald of Kent. The hamlet is characterized by a scattering of residential properties and farmsteads, reflecting a quiet, traditional English countryside setting. Its modest size and green surroundings contribute to its identity as a peaceful, agricultural community.
